How To Fix /SAPAPO/TSM492 - Objects are permitted to be imported into target system


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PAPO/TSM -

  • Message number: 492

  • Message text: Objects are permitted to be imported into target system

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SAPAPO/TSM492 - Objects are permitted to be imported into target system ?

    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/TSM492 indicates that there are restrictions on importing certain objects into the target system. This error typically arises in the context of S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) when trying to transport or import objects that are not permitted due to various reasons.

    Cause:

    1.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to import the specified objects.
    2. Configuration Settings: The target system may have specific settings that restrict the import of certain types of objects.
    3. Transport Request Issues: The transport request may not be correctly configured or may contain objects that are not allowed to be imported into the target system.
    4. Version Compatibility: The objects being imported may not be compatible with the version of the target system.

    Solution:

    1. Check Authorizations: Ensure that the user performing the import has the necessary authorizations to import the objects. This can be done by reviewing the user's roles and authorizations in the SAP system.
    2. Review Transport Request: Check the transport request for any inconsistencies or errors. Make sure that the objects included in the transport request are valid and allowed for import.
    3. System Configuration: Review the configuration settings of the target system to ensure that it allows the import of the specified objects. This may involve checking system parameters or settings related to transport management.
    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ific objects you are trying to import. There may be specific guidelines or restrictions outlined by SAP.
    5.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ance. They can provide insights based on the specific context of your system and the objects involved.
